We loved it here. Close to the underground for getting us downtown while staying in what felt like a quaint neighborhood. Enjoyed going down stairs for the breakfast every morning. The building it's self is older but has a charm about it. Our room for three was tight and so was the restroom but we were comfortable. No air conditioning (fan included), don't know what it would felt like if the weather was warn, it was pleasant during our stay and we liked opening the windows. There is a nice lobby or waiting area with a baby grand piano for guests to play - though it is in serious need of tuning. Restaurants and general stores about a 5-15 min walk. On week days there were open air stands offering various international hot food freshly prepared just outside the underground - very tasty.

Unique and interesting hotel in an old mansion. Sure, it could use a refresh, but the rooms are huge by London standards and good value for the price. Staff are very friendly and go out of their way to make your stay comfortable. Great location in a quiet part of town but mere steps from the tube station. No breakfast since COVID, but lots of reasonable options within an easy walk.
